This characterful home forms part of one of the original buildings within the former Arcon Village Bleaching Works, thoughtfully converted as part of a carefully planned regeneration of this historic site. The property was completed during a later phase of the development and was originally sold as a new conversion in 2011.

The accommodation is particularly flexible and well balanced, making the property suitable for a wide range of buyers, including families, professionals and those seeking adaptable living space.

To the ground floor, an inviting entrance hall leads to a downstairs WC and a superb open-plan kitchen, dining and living area, designed with modern lifestyles in mind. The kitchen is well equipped with integrated appliances and benefits from a useful pantry/store, adding to its practicality.

The first floor offers a generous and versatile room that could serve equally well as a spacious living room or a substantial double bedroom, alongside a family bathroom.

The top floor provides two additional bedrooms, one of which enjoys the benefit of an en suite shower room, creating an excellent principal bedroom suite.

Externally, the property benefits from allocated parking to the front, while the beautifully maintained communal grounds wrap around the development and provide an attractive setting. These landscaped areas, combined with the conservation-area location, truly set this development apart and enhance its appeal.

The sellers inform us that the property is Leasehold for a term of 999 years from 1st September 2004 subject to the payment of a yearly Ground Rent of £150

Council Tax is Band D - £2,297.19Ground Floor
